The food did take about 35 minutes to come out, but we expected that with it being opening month. Unfortunately, they were out of the beer option my husband originally ordered, and his second beer choice (a Yuengling) came to us flat. He ended up switching to a Dos Equis. I had the boneless wings and he had traditional and both were solid and consistent with what we expect from Buffalo Wild Wings.
Where the experience fell short was with the management. There were five managers visibly walking around, but not one stopped by our table to check in, ask how the food was, or engage with guests. They were talking among themselves, and the staff around them seemed unsure or lost at times. As someone who used to work at BWW and helped open a location, I was surprised to see this level of detachment, especially during opening month when leadership presence and guest connection are crucial.
A table behind us was open and had all of the managers laptops, water bottles, and paperwork all over it. A manager came to sit down to work while we were eating. For a busy restaurant, this takes away a table from a server and also just looks cheap.
Given the lower ratings this location has received, I was hoping to see management stepping up. The front-of-house team (like Nicole) is doing their best, but stronger support and visibility from leadership would really elevate the experience.
